A few months back, millions of americans found out they will qualify for hundreds of dollars through President Bush's economic stimulus package.
But is your tax rebate check free money or is there a catch?
One hundred sixty-eight billion dollars will be shipped out to Americans who qualify for a portion of the economic stimulus package.
Once word got out that $168 billion are being shipped out as early as May, some people thought the rebate is a loan from the government and that you would have to pay it back or that it would actually increase your taxes.
A spokesperson for the IRS says, "The Tax Rebate is not going to reduce your refund for 2008 or increase any taxes you owe for 2008."
If you already owe federal or state taxes, the rebate check will be applied to that first just like a regular tax refund.
Checks are expected to come as early as May.
